(2) Two runners may not occupy a base, but if, while the ball is alive, two runners are touching a base, the following runner shall be out when tagged and the preceding runner is entitled to the base, unless Rule 5.06 (b) (2) applies. (a) Two runners may not occupy a base, but if, while the ball is alive, two runners are touching a base, the following runner shall be out when tagged and the preceding runner is entitled to the base, unless Rule 7.03 (b) applies. However, for rule 7.03(b), if the batter-runner is put out first by tag or touching first base before a play is made on the preceding runner, the force play on the preceding runner is removed and the preceding runner is not required to advance.
